Comprehending Auto Key Duplication

Auto key duplication is the process of developing a replica of a vehicle key. The demand for this service has grown substantially with the increase in vehicle ownership and the differing intricacies of car locks. From conventional metal keys to modern transponder keys, the duplication procedure can vary extensively.

Kinds Of Car Keys

Before delving into the auto key duplication procedure, it's crucial to understand the different kinds of keys that exist:

Type of KeyDescriptionDuplication Process
Conventional Metal KeysBasic keys that do not consist of electronic elements.Simple duplication utilizing a key cutting machine.
Transponder KeysKeys which contain a chip set to interact with the car's ignition system.Needs shows devices to produce a new key with the correct chip.
Smart KeysKeyless entry systems that utilize a fob or card.Needs specialized tools and setting to duplicate.
Valet KeysLimited-function keys developed for valet parking.Simple duplication, however may not deal with all cars.

The Auto Key Duplication Process

The procedure of auto key duplication can vary based on the type of key being duplicated. Below is a breakdown of the procedure for each key type.

  1. Conventional Metal Keys:

    • Step 1: The original key is placed into a key cutting machine.
    • Action 2: The device cuts a new key by following the grooves of the initial key.
    • Step 3: The recently cut key is evaluated for accuracy versus the original.
  2. Transponder Keys:

    • Step 1: The initial key is scanned to read the transponder chip's information.
    • Action 2: A new key is cut, and the transponder chip is programmed to match the vehicle's unique code.
    • Action 3: Testing includes verifying that the key can begin the vehicle.
  3. Smart Keys:

    • Step 1: The original wise key is analyzed to draw out coding info.
    • Action 2: The new key fob is configured with the essential codes.
    • Action 3: The key's functionality is verified with the vehicle system.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Just how much does it cost to duplicate an auto key?

The expense of duplicating a car key can differ widely based upon the key type. Traditional keys may cost between ₤ 1 to ₤ 5, while transponder keys can range from ₤ 20 to ₤ 150. Smart keys might cost much more due to their innovative technology.

2. Can I duplicate a key myself?

While it is technically possible to duplicate a traditional key utilizing a portable key cutter, duplicating chips and clever keys typically requires customized tools and knowledge. It's a good idea to go to an expert locksmith or a dealer for these kinds of keys.

3. What should I do if I lose my only key?

If you lose your only key, your best alternative is to contact an expert locksmith or your vehicle dealer. They can develop a new key, though this may involve extra steps like setting the new key to the vehicle's ignition system.

4. Are there risks related to key duplication?

The primary risk related to key duplication is having a duplicate key fall into the wrong hands. To reduce this danger, it's vital to just duplicate keys at credible services and to monitor who has access to your spare keys.
